SPECS:
  • 15.6" WQHD (2560 x 1440) 16:9, 165Hz (3ms), 300-nits, 100% DCI-P3, Anti-glare IPS Display
  • AMD Ryzen 9 6900HS 8 Cores (3.3GHz-4.9GHz, 16MB Cache, 35W)
  • N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 6GB GDDR6 with ROG Boost up to 1475MHz at 120W (1425MHz Boost Clock+50MHz OC, 100W+20W Dynamic Boost)
  • 16GB (8GB onboard + 8GB) DDR5 4800MHz RAM
  • 512GB NVMe PCIe 4.0 SSD
  • Windows 11 Home
  • 720P HD IR Camera for Windows Hello
  • Backlit Chiclet RGB Keyboard
  • 90WHrs, 4S1P, 4-cell Li-ion Battery
  • 4.19 lbs
  • Model: GA503RM-G15.R93060
  • Ports:
    • 2x USB 3.2 Type A (Gen 2)
    • 2x USB 3.2 Type C (Gen 2) [Support DisplayPort and Power Delivery]
    • 1x 3.5mm Combo Audio Jack
    • 1x HDMI 2.0b
    • 1x RJ45 LAN port
    • 1x Card Reader (microSD) (UHS-II)
